[Opalvoip-user] obvious errors in Opal: ruby_msvc_wrapper.cxx and assert.cxx(283) Assertion fail
Brought to you by:
csoutheren,
rjongbloed
From: Dmitry <gor...@mt...> - 2009-12-26 22:07:36
|
1). I tryed 23899 ... 2>c1xx : fatal error C1083: Cannot open source file: '..\..\..\svn-trunk\opal\src\ruby\ruby_msvc_wrapper.cxx': No such file or directory I do not know what is this 'ruby', but now it is not possible to compile 2) 1:03.981 Pool:3832 assert.cxx(283) Assertion fail: Media patch thread not terminated., file ..\opal\patch.cxx, line 139 DbgHelpCreateUserDump(0, 0, 0, 0) + 0x14b Is it fixed? I can not confirm it. To fix it need to do (in t38proto.cxx): void OpalFaxConnection::OnStopMediaPatch(OpalMediaPatch & patch) // Not an explicit switch, so fax plug in indicated end of fax // if (m_faxMediaStreamsSwitchState == e_NotSwitchingFaxMediaStreams) { // synchronousOnRelease = false; // Get deadlock if OnRelease() from patch thread. // OnFaxCompleted(false); // } After doing this, need to fix double-statistics (twice PhaseE after sending t38fax) |